Pouring Hot Sauce On Your Wound: How Capsaicin Is Changing Pain Relief
Go to: Previous Article Next Article
It might sound like a horrible thing to do, but scientists both in Europe and the United States have started dripping hot sauce on open wounds. They say that chili peppers might hold the real key to after-surgery pain relief. A pain specialist from Denmark named Dr. Eske Aasvang and a California-based company Anesiva, Inc. are utilizing a purified phytochemical chemical called capsaicin to help patients get over the pain of surgery.
Chili peppers have typically been utilized as a topical painkiller, with capsaicin creams available in tubes or jars or being the active ingredient in heating pads available for sale at many drugstores. It may also relieve itching (pruritis). Among the conditions it is utilized for are back pain, bursitis, fibromyalgia, joint pain, muscle pain.
Capsaicin or 8-methyl N-vanillyl 6nonamide is one of the six capsaicinoid compounds in chili peppers, and is what gives them their unique mouth-burning, eye-watering, and sweat-breaking spiciness.
It Functions by activating the chemical terminals of sensory neurons which raises membrane permeability to elements such as calcium and sodium, thereby triggering the release of substance P, the substance accountable for the sensations of pain we experience inside our mouths when consuming a habanero chili pepper. The chemical terminals are receptors called transient receptor potential cation channel subfamily V member 1 (TRPV1). When they bind with capsaicin, they open and permit the latter to get into specific pain fibers, allowing excess calcium inside the cells until the nerves become overloaded and shut down. When these cells shut down, it temporarily numbs the feeling in that specific area where it was applied.
The brain responds to the burning sensation by bringing out endorphins, the body's natural painkiller.
Endorphins are a class of neurotransmitters produced by the body to respond to any type of pain, and bonds to several of the exact same receptors in the brain like the opioid morphine. The term itself is really a blend of two words coined by American scientists Rabi Simantov and Solomon H. Snyder, "endogenous" and "morphine" and literally means "morphine produced naturally in the body." Endorphins are also recognized to bring about a sense of well-being, and is the attributed cause of a phenomenon called "runner's high." This is largely simply because its release is triggered by exercise, which puts an excellent deal of wear and tear on the body and leading to muscle pain. The muscle pain in turn becomes the signal for the body to release endorphins. Similarly, capsaicin has also been recognized to trigger the release of endorphins.
But it is the feeling of numbness that scientists want to investigate further. By bathing surgically exposed nerves in a high enough dose of capsaicin, the spot should be numbed for weeks, translating to less pain and suffering for those who have just gone through surgery. It indicates that patients will require much less opioid painkillers as they heal. Opioid painkillers are also tangled up with serious side effects that minimize their use, and are likely addictive.
Even though the application for chili peppers for pain relief after surgical procedure is yet to be approved by the US Food and Drug Administration, many scientists are optimistic that capsaicin is the future of pain relief.
